function searchaclick()
{
  var q = document.getElementById("searchq");
  if( q == null ) return true;
  if( q.value == "" ) return true;
  searchgo();
  return false;
}

function searchgo()
{
  var q = document.getElementById("searchq");
  var f = document.getElementById("searchf");

  if( (q == null) || (f == null) ) return;
  if( q.value == "" )
  {
    alert( "Please enter at least one keyword" );
    q.focus();
    return;
  }

  if( f.value == "snmp" )
  {
    var newloc = "/mibs_search.aspx?q=" + encodeURIComponent( q.value ) + "&";
    window.location = newloc;
    return;
  }

  var newloc = "/search.aspx?q=" + encodeURIComponent( q.value ) + "&";
  if( f.value != "" ) newloc += "f=" + encodeURIComponent( f.value ) + "&";
  window.location = newloc;
}

function searchkeydown(e)
{
  var keycode;
  if (window.event) keycode = window.event.keyCode;
  else if (e) keycode = e.which;
  else return true;

  if (keycode == 13)
  {
    searchgo();
    return false;
  }

  return true;
}


